Contrasting Thai Massage to Various Other Massage Styles
How does Thai massage differ from other massage styles? Thai massage therapy, rooted in old recovery practices, emphasizes extending and power circulation as opposed to just muscle adjustment. Unlike Swedish massage therapy, which focuses on leisure with gentle strokes, Thai massage therapy incorporates acupressure strategies and yoga-like postures to boost adaptability and power flow. The expert utilizes their hands, feet, and elbow joints to use pressure along power lines, or "sen," facilitating a special mix of physical and energised benefits.In contrast to deep tissue massage, which targets certain muscular tissue knots and tension, Thai massage advertises total body awareness and all natural recovery. In addition, the session generally happens on a mat instead of a table, permitting a more vibrant interaction between the client and specialist. This unique method not just relieves stress but also stimulates the body, making Thai massage therapy a flexible alternative for those looking for both relaxation and restoration.

The length of time Does a Common Thai Massage Session Last?
A regular Thai massage session normally lasts between 60 to 120 mins. The period frequently relies on the client's needs and choices, permitting a customized experience that addresses various tension points effectively.

What Should I Put on Throughout a Thai Massage therapy?
When considering outfit for a Thai massage therapy, it is recommended to wear loose, comfortable apparel that permits very easy movement (Reflexology). Lightweight, breathable materials are suggested to boost leisure and facilitate the massage experience effectively
